  • noun gagged Put a gag on (someone). 1
  • verb with object gagged to introduce usually comic interpolations into (a script, an actor's part, or the like) (usually followed by up). 1
  • verb without object gagged to tell jokes or make amusing remarks. 1
  • verb without object gagged to introduce gags in acting. 1
  • verb without object gagged to play on another's credulity, as by telling false stories. 1
  • noun gagged a joke, especially one introduced into a script or an actor's part. 1
  • noun gagged any contrived piece of wordplay or horseplay. 1
